Murray Place is a delightful cul-de-sac that is home to a small number of picturesque cottages set within the conservation village of Luss that sits on the western shores of Loch Lomonds National Park.

Luss is a fantastic place to live, being picture postcard perfect enjoying a lovely quiet location yet within easy reach of good amenities found within the nearby towns of Balloch, Dumbarton and Helensburgh. The acclaimed Loch Lomond Golf Club and the Carrick Golf Club and Spa are only a short distance away and the area is perfect for those who enjoy the outdoor life with fantastic scenery all round. There are lovely country walks and hill climbs nearby and the village has a small primary school, post office and the recently refurbished Loch Lomond Arms Hotel offering great bar food and a restaurant. Luss Church is within a short stroll and there are some excellent coffee shops and souvenir shops in and around the village. Glasgow can be reached by car in around forty-five minutes with the International Airport accessible via the Erskine Bridge. Helensburgh is about a ten minute drive away where there are regular train services to Glasgow and Edinburgh and with a wide selection of shops and amenities on offer.

The property itself enjoys an end terraced position and the house offers attractive garden grounds that are approached by a pedestrian lane to the front of the property which gives access from the road. To the front the gardens are stone chipped, with wrought iron gate opening from the lane into a path leading to the front door. Beyond the lane, the gardens feature further flower beds and beech hedging. To the rear the gardens are level with patio area, fencing on the periphery and side gate to front.

On entering the cottage, the ground floor offers a bright and well-proportioned lounge to the front of the house with views across the gardens; there is a feature wood burner fire with surround. The lounge is laid out semi-open plan with a separate dining area to the rear overlooking the back gardens. The kitchen to the rear of the property has been fitted with modern wall mounted and counter level units and comes with a free-standing cooker and extractor hood and there is a washing machine, dishwasher and fridge included. A window and door lead on to the back gardens. The downstairs shower room has a modern suite, also downstairs is a useful third bedroom. Moving onto the upstairs, the landing gives access to two good sized bedrooms with windows looking to the rear of the house with lovely open outlooks, there is also a handy upstairs WC.

The property is warmed by electric panel heaters and boiler for constant water and wood burner fire; windows are replacement uPVC double glazed units.
